Sheffield will receive a new arts centre as a London-based organisation relocates to the area.

Arts Catalyst, a charity that commissions science and technology-based work, is moving from King's Cross to Sheffield later this year.

Artistic Director Laura Clarke said the city has "an amazing DIY ethos and quite an exciting, growing cultural landscape at the moment".

"If you think about the ways we work, and the subjects we're interested in, Sheffield feels like it has a lot of synergies."

Its team is looking for a suitable building in which to set up the new centre, which will have a gallery, research area and possibly creative workspaces.
